The Bellicose MindsBuzz or Howl Sessions

The Bellicose Minds plays eerie, dark post punk that fits the weather and atmosphere here in Portland. I’m not sure if this band still active, they haven’t released anything since their excellent 2016 LP The Creature - but this here is their earliest recordings, and it’s the same gloomy apocalyptic vibe. The best way to describe it is music that you can both dance to, overdose to or commit suicide to. Musically it’s not complex - repetitive even; bass-forward, lots of hi-hat 32nd notes, with slightly monotone vocals that fit this genre so well - clearly Joy Division inspired but not a direct rip. There is a bit of anarchist / peace punk in here too.

The insert shows the Portland scene in a nutshell - at least maybe before I moved here - they’ve played with bands all over the spectrum - Poison Idea, War Cry, Tragedy, Defiance - along with similar bands like Belgrado, Arctic Flowers, and the Mob.

Originally the band’s demo, this recording was reissued as a 10” in 2014 - my copy is on clear (100). The songs are from 2009.
